The Philips Avent Pacifiers have features that distinguish it
The difference between Philips Avent pacifiers and most of the ordinary models is the consideration of their orthodontic advantages. The pacifiers nipples consist of soft, medical-grade silicone which tastes and smells free, which makes it more likely to be accepted by babies. The silicone is also hard enough to give mild resistance that facilitates an appropriate sucking behavior but does not strain the developing jaw.
The other notable characteristic is the symmetrical design. Philips Avent pacifiers may be worn in either direction as opposed to the normal pacifiers that may only fit in one position. This means that the baby will not need to continuously change and this will aid in avoiding bad sucking habits that may disrupt oral development. Most of the models also have ventilation holes on the shield to ensure that there is flow of air to keep the skin of the baby dry and to minimize irritation of the mouth. These features combined together form a pacifier that helps in comfort and development.
The Right Pacifier at the Age of Your Baby
Philips Avent pacifiers are available in various sizes, each one corresponding to a particular age group; 0-6 months, 6-18 months and 18+ months. The issue of the correct size is not only about comfort but also has a direct effect on the development of the mouth. An undersized pacifier might fail to offer sufficient gum support whereas an oversized one might be unpleasant and might cause a child to avoid the sucking habit.
The lightweight shielded smaller pacifiers are best in the case of the newborns, as they would not choke over the size of the pacifier. As your baby matures and his or her jaw and teeth start growing up, changing to the next size will aid in his or her proper oral support. Philips Avent has also given clear guidelines to every stage of their product, thus parents have an easier time selecting the appropriate choice without any guesswork. It is always best to stay at the right size so that your baby gets to enjoy the comfort as well as natural oral growth in each stage.

Pacifier Oral Health: How to Take Care of Oral Health
Although Philips Avent pacifier is developed keeping in mind the level of oral health, the parents still have a significant role to play in proper usage. It is imperative to keep clean and therefore in the initial six months, when the immune system of your baby is still in the process of building, cleaning is necessary. Wash the pacifier prior to the initial usage and wash on a daily basis with warm, soaped water or use a baby-safe sterilizer.
Pacifiers should also be checked to see whether they are worn out. Babies who are in the teething period might chew more vigorously and this can destroy the silicone after some time. In case you will find cracks, tears, or change of the texture, change the pacifier. To be safe and hygienic, Philips Avent suggests the replacement of pacifiers after every four weeks. To continue with the habits, the pacifier can be a safe and beneficial device of not only comfort but oral development.
Establishing Healthy Give-Up HABits
The use of pacifiers can be the good aspect in the growth of your baby provided that they will be used in moderation and balance. You do not have to give pacifiers all the time; only at the moments when your baby is in need of comfort, bedtime, or at the moment baby is fussy, then such use would be advised. This will avoid excessive dependency and will make sure that you baby is also taught other techniques of calming down.
You also should plan to wean your baby once it becomes older. Majority of the experts suggest that the habit of pacifier should be started in between two and three years of age to prevent the long term dental consequences. Philips Avent orthodontic design would allow you to use the pacifier during the early years without any fear that it would cause harm due to the nature of the design, but you must have a transition strategy that will ensure that the child does not develop any issues during the later years.
